Abstract
A wireless device that tailors communications based on power parameters of the device. In one embodiment, a wireless device includes an energy source, a power monitor coupled to the energy source, a wireless transceiver, and a traffic controller coupled to the power monitor and the wireless transceiver. The power monitor is configured to measure a parameter of the energy source. The wireless transceiver is configured to wirelessly communicate via a wireless network. The traffic controller is configured to dynamically provide traffic management based on a prediction of wireless device capabilities using the present state of the energy source.

13. A method, comprising:
-
providing a present state of an energy source powering a wireless device by measuring an output voltage of the energy source; determining, based on the measured output voltage of the energy source, a packet length for which the energy source provides sufficient power to enable reception of the packet without errors caused by reduction in output voltage of the energy source during the reception of the packet; and transmitting a packet via a wireless network to a node of the wireless network, the packet including information indicative of the packet length.
